Energy-Saving Design Techniques
The selection of green construction materials enables implementing energy-saving design strategies in architecture. Designers are progressively incorporating passive solar techniques, which maximizes natural light and reduces energy consumption. Orientation of structures is thoughtfully evaluated to improve solar supplementary information exposure while decreasing thermal loss. Moreover, high-performance insulation and high-efficiency windows are employed to improve thermal comfort and reduce dependence on HVAC systems. Incorporating clean energy sources, such as solar panels, additionally promotes sustainability goals. Furthermore, smart building technologies allow continuous energy tracking, ensuring efficient resource management. These approaches collectively contribute to lower energy use and a reduced carbon footprint, demonstrating a dedication to eco-conscious living in contemporary architecture.
Waste Lowering Practices
Implementing waste reduction techniques is vital for fostering eco-consciousness in architecture. Leading firms are continually adopting practices that decrease material waste throughout the design and construction processes. Techniques such as modular design allow for prefabrication, reducing excess materials and streamlining construction timelines. In addition, architects are prioritizing the use of recycled or reclaimed materials, thereby lowering the demand for new resources. Waste audits during construction help identify areas for improvement, enabling firms to track and reduce their waste output effectively. Moreover, integrating design for disassembly principles ensures that buildings can be easily repurposed or recycled at the end of their lifecycle. These innovative approaches not only contribute to environmental sustainability but also enhance the overall efficiency of architectural projects.

Finding the Most Suitable Architecture Firm that Fits Your Requirements
How does one navigate the selection of the ideal architecture firm? This decision requires several essential factors. First, prospective clients should evaluate the firm's portfolio to ensure its design style aligns with their goals. Next, examining the firm's expertise in specific project categories, such as residential, commercial, or sustainable design, can offer insight into their expertise.
Client reviews and testimonials deliver valuable insights on the firm's reliability and collaborative methodology. Additionally, evaluating the firm's approach to communication and project management is vital; effective communication can significantly shape the project's results.
Price considerations are similarly critical; clients should explore fee structures upfront to avert misunderstandings in the future. Additionally, personal rapport with the architects can foster effective collaboration throughout the design process. By thoughtfully examining these factors, clients can make sound decisions, ultimately establishing a successful partnership that fulfills their architectural requirements.

How Much Are Professional Design Services Normally?
Architectural expertise generally range from $100 to $250 per hour, subject to the firm's reputation and degree of difficulty. Fixed fees for individual endeavors are sometimes extended, regularly comprising 5% to 15% of construction costs.
